How to see it
HIP 8210 has a visual magnitude of about 6.53: it usually needs binoculars or a small telescope, especially from light-polluted sites.
Sky position
Equatorial coordinates for HIP 8210: right ascension 1h 45m 43s, declination +8° 33′ 33″ (J2000), in the region of the Cetus constellation (IAU figure Cet).
